Kingster Posted October 11, 2022 Posted October 11, 2022 The 170? If you mean the ST170, that’s actually a Zetec (uprated Blacktop with VVT) and was just called “duratec” by the marketing dept 🙄
Kingster Posted October 11, 2022 Posted October 11, 2022 In terms of cost, it depends on a few things. Zetecs are thin on the ground these days and will probably be very high miles. Sadly you can no longer pick up a new crate engine for under £1k like you could 5-6 years ago. But Duratecs will still be available with reasonable wear second hand and likely cheaper than a zetec. The cost of the add ons, if starting from scratch, (sump, induction, exhaust, ecu, plumbing, alternator etc) will be roughly comparable though. Plus - exhaust exit matches 😁
